Hamm v. State

404 S.W.3d 406, 2013 WL 3807895, 2013 Mo. App. LEXIS 867
Missouri Court of Appeals·Decided July 23, 2013·No. No. WD 75489·Published

Opinion

ORDER

PER CURIAM:

Mr. Bobby Hamm, Jr. appeals the trial court’s judgment denying a Rule 24.035 motion for post-conviction relief. He alleges ineffective assistance of counsel because plea counsel assured him that by entering an open plea to the charge of first-degree statutory rape, he would receive no more than a fifteen-year sentence.

For reasons stated in the memorandum provided to the parties, we affirm. Rule 84.16(b).
